FAQ
What is total return?
Total return includes both capital appreciation (price change) and income (dividends).
Why use annualized return?
Annualized return normalizes returns to a yearly rate, making it easier to compare investments held for different periods.
Should I include reinvested dividends?
If dividends were reinvested in more shares, include those additional shares and reduce reported dividends accordingly.
